<tr class="firstalt"><td width="55%" height=25  id='submitrow'><p align="left">
         &nbsp;&nbsp;年级:<select size="1" name="grade_id" onChange="return goToPage()" onSelect="return goToPage()">  
         <option  value="0">年级选择</option>
<%
  String grade_id=(String)request.getAttribute("grade_id");
  if(grade_id==null)
  {
    grade_id="0";
  }
%>
<logic:iterate id="allgrade"  name="allgrade" type="com.ideacom.siis.domain.GradeInfo">
 <logic:equal name="allgrade" property="gradeId" value="<%=grade_id%>">
         <option value="<bean:write name="allgrade" property="gradeId"/>" selected><bean:write name="allgrade" property="gradeName"/></option>
  </logic:equal>
  <logic:notEqual name="allgrade" property="gradeId" value="<%=grade_id%>">
         <option value="<bean:write name="allgrade" property="gradeId"/>"><bean:write name="allgrade" property="gradeName"/></option>
  </logic:notEqual>
</logic:iterate>

     </select>
 班级:<select size="1" name="class_id" onChange="return goToPage()" onSelect="return goToPage()">
 <option  value="0">班级选择</option> 
<%
      String classid=(String)request.getAttribute("class_id");
  if(classid==null)
  {
    classid="0";
  }
   %>
<logic:iterate id="allclass"  name="allclass" type="com.ideacom.siis.domain.ClassInfo">

 <logic:equal name="allclass" property="classId" value="<%=classid%>">
         <option value="<bean:write name="allclass" property="classId"/>" selected><bean:write name="allclass" property="className"/></option>
  </logic:equal>
  <logic:notEqual name="allclass" property="classId" value="<%=classid%>">
         <option value="<bean:write name="allclass" property="classId"/>"><bean:write name="allclass" property="className"/></option>
  </logic:notEqual>
</logic:iterate> 

         </select> 
     学生:<select size="1" name="stdt_id"  onChange="return goToPage()" onSelect="return goToPage()">
         <option value="0">学生选择</option>
<%
      String stdtid=(String)request.getAttribute("stdt_id");
  if(stdtid==null)
  {
    stdtid="0";
  }   String msg_type=(String)request.getAttribute("msg_type");
  if(msg_type==null)
  {
    msg_type="0";
  }
   %>
<logic:iterate id="allstdt"  name="allstdt" type="com.ideacom.siis.domain.SendStdt">

 <logic:equal name="allstdt" property="stdt_id" value="<%=stdtid%>">
         <option value="<bean:write name="allstdt" property="stdt_id"/>" selected><bean:write name="allstdt" property="stdt_name"/></option>
  </logic:equal>
  <logic:notEqual name="allstdt" property="stdt_id" value="<%=stdtid%>">
         <option value="<bean:write name="allstdt" property="stdt_id"/>"><bean:write name="allstdt" property="stdt_name"/></option>
  </logic:notEqual>
</logic:iterate> 
         </select> 能看懂吗??我这个可是有三个select互相递联的,完全可以满足你的要求
记得给分呦